Transaction ca40ff590c2cf107371ae8ec8cec2ce36d2e45ffce7d843be0c134fc89e04360

1 Input
2 Outputs
  • ca40ff590c2cf107371ae8ec8cec2ce36d2e45ffce7d843be0c134fc89e04360:0
  • value  14593131098
    address  12AAjEGGcjtePror4RMPrCPrxL67HbTpoW
  • ca40ff590c2cf107371ae8ec8cec2ce36d2e45ffce7d843be0c134fc89e04360:1
  • value  1000000
    address  1H7XpqFghRKESMXW4VHRhWFbJe5xnEkTdY